Introduction
PREFACE
  • These operating instructions are designed to familiarize the operator with the machine and its designated use. The operating instructions contain important information on how to operate the machine safely, properly and with maximum efficiency. Observing these instructions helps to prevent hazardous situations, to reduce repair costs and downtimes and to increase the reliability and service life of the machine.
  • The operating instructions must be supplemented by the respective national rules and regulations for accident prevention and environmental protection. The operating instructions must always be available in the driver’s cab of the machine. The operating instructions must be read and put into practice by any person in charge of carrying out work with or on the machine, such as
-operation, including setting-up, troubleshooting in the course of work, care, evacuation of production waste and disposal of fuels and consumables,
-maintenance (inspection, servicing, repair) and / or
-transport.
  • In addition to the operating instructions and the mandatory rules and regulations for accident prevention and environmental protection in the user’s country and at the place where the machine is to be used, the generally recognized technical rules for safe and proper working must be observed 1 The operating instructions are directed to the construction- machine specialist. They cannot provide basic know-how.
  • This can be acquired, for example, in several days’ instruction by a qualified mechanic or by attending an Terex|O&K training course for operators or maintenance personnel. The Terex|O&K after-sales service will be pleased to deal with any queries you may have after reading through the operating instructions. All Terex|O&K operating manuals are issued in German and then translated.
  • Even a good translation may give rise to questions which Terex|O&K will be pleased to answer. The operating instructions are not work instructions for carrying out major repairs. Such work is willingly done for you by the Terex|O&K aftersales service.
  • The documentation relating to the machine is listed according to scope, quantity and language in the shipping note of the machine or in the covering letter if supplied separately. The operating instructions and spare-parts list are marked with the serial number of the machine.
  • On taking receipt of the consignment, please check that the documentation is complete and in the language requested by you.
